FO 371/140366

Political relations between Saudi Arabia and UK. Code BS file 1051 (papers 45 to 56), 1959

This file relates to efforts to restore diplomatic relations between Britain and Saudi Arabia. It contains correspondence concerning: P Dixon's meeting with UN Secretary General Dag Hammarskjöld. The latter accepts Britain's basic position for the restoration of relations, but is reluctant to identify himself with the British position prematurely (45) Revised draft of Hammarskjöld's reply to Prince Faisal Bin Abdul Aziz Al Saud. HMG agrees to the text, but asks for a delay in its despatch until the Sultan of Muscat and the Ruler of Abu Dhabi are informed of the proposals.

FO 371/126938

Frontier dispute between Kuwait and Iraq, 1957

This file concerns the dispute over the Kuwait-Iraq frontier. It contains correspondence relating to: Kuwait's insistence on a demarcation of the frontier as a condition of any agreement for an oil pipeline from Basra across Kuwait; the Ruler of Kuwait's appeal to HMG to resolve the boundary issue; and discussions about how to bring about further talks between the two sides.
